The Saatva Youth

The Saatva Youth mattress is a dual-sided innerspring made for children. It's a great option for children due to its dual-sided design can be adapted to changing needs. It's a high-quality, durable mattress that will last for a long time. You won't have to worry about replacing it if your child is no longer using it.

Saatva Youth's top layer is made of a soft organic cover that breathes and is that is treated with Guardin antimicrobial protection. It's also a hypoallergenic mattress, which makes it an ideal choice for children with sensitive skin or allergies. The innerspring layer is a traditional design and should feel supple and bouncy. This makes it easier for kids to move around in their sleep and change positions throughout the night. It must also be cool to touch, which is crucial for kids since they tend to be more sensitive to heat than adults.

You'll find two comfort layers beneath the organic cotton layer: a main layer for children ranging from 3-7, and an additional layer for children aged 8 to 12 years. The side designed for children who are younger is more plush, and is better suited for back and stomach sleepers and combination sleepers. The other side is more firm and better suited to sleepers who are light to moderate. Both sides have five zones of support. The center is firmer to align the spine, whereas the head and feet are softer to provide pressure relief.

The Saatva Youth mattress is a hybrid mattress with foams and innersprings within the comfort layer as well as the primary support layer. The innersprings are found in the primary support layer on the young kids ' side, and the foams in the main support layer on the older kid's side. The foams are constructed with a copper-infused fabric that should help keep the sleep surface cooler than standard. The Saatva Youth is an eco-friendly mattress that meets the federal standards for chemical emissions and utilizes non-toxic foams in its manufacturing processes. It is also manufactured in America and the majority of its components being from the US. Saatva recommends that it be used in conjunction with box springs or a platform, but also recommends a foundation of $200 to accommodate the non-standard construction. The Saatva Youth is backed by a generous 120-night home trial, 24/7 support for customers and a lifetime guarantee.

The majority of bunk beds have standard twin mattresses, however certain models can accommodate twin XL mattresses or full-size beds. Make sure you take measurements before purchasing the mattress. You should ensure that the mattress fits the bed frame and will not hinder access to doors, windows, or other furniture. Bunk mattresses are also more likely to create more noise than traditional mattresses, therefore look for all foam and hybrid mattresses that are quieter.

A mattress should have a medium firm feel to provide support to stomach, back and side sleepers. It must also have a good contouring to alleviate pressure points, which is essential for side sleepers. A mattress that is too firm could cause lower back pain, so the perfect mattress for bunk beds is one that offers support and cushioning.

When shopping for bunk bed mattresses be sure to consider the sleeping position of the person who will use it the most. For side sleepers choosing a cushioned surface is the best option to avoid shoulder and hip pain. Back and stomach sleepers require a firmer mattress to ensure their spines are protected. The Nectar Original is a great option for all sleepers because it comes with several layers of foam that conform to the body and ease pressure points.

The Nectar is also a great choice for kids because it has a low profile. A bunk mattress with a high-profile can cause the top mattress to rise up over the guard rails which could increase the risk of falling off the top bunk during the night. A mattress with a lower loft will be more secure and easier to move into and out of and out of, making it easier for children to put their feet on the bed and change the sheets.
